Jumat, 18 Mei 2012

BASIS DATA




Suatu Data Base Management System (DBMS) terdiri dari sekumpulan data yang saling berhubungan dan suatu himpunan program yang melakukan akses terhadap data tersebut
Tujuan dari DBMS yang paling utama adalah efisien danconvinient
Manajemen data melibatkan baik struktur informasi dan mekanisme dalam melakukan manipulasi terhadap informasi

KOMPONEN BASIS DATA
DATA,          : data tersimpan secara terintegrasi dan dipakai secara bersama-sama
HARDWARE, : perangkat keras yang digunakan dalam mengelola sistem database
SOFTWARE, ; perangkat lunak perantara antara pemakai dengan data fisik. perangkat lunak
                    dapat berupa data base management system dan berbagai program aplikasi
USER,         : sebagai pemakai sistem

 
Properti penting DBMS adalah data independency yang dapat dideskripsikan sebagai kondisi   di mana data dan program aplikasi independen dalam arti perubahan tidak saling mempengaruhi
 
Program aplikasi tidak dipengaruhi perubahan yang dilakukan terhadap data dan cara data     tersebut diorganisasikan secara fisik oleh DBMS
 
DBMS memberi abstraksi pengelolaan informasi pada level logik. Pandangan logik tidak tergantung pada representasi fisik secara berarti.
Contoh : pengaksesan rekord tertentu muncul pada pandangan logik sebagai seperti mengakses tabel, sementara sesungguhnya file disimpan sebagai file hash yang mengerjakan algoritma transformasi kunci ke alamat
kerumitan-kerumitan di tingkat pengaksesan rekord yang sesungguhnya tidak perlu diketahui pemakai DBMS 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1. DBMS memberi abstraksi pengelolaan informasi pada level logik. 
2. Pemakai berhubungan dengan DBMS melalui konsep logik DBMS 
       3. DBMS berinteraksi dngan sistem pengelolaan file FMS (File Management system)   
           untuk transformasi informasi level logik menjadi level fisik.
4. FMS menggunakanfungsi-fungsi primitif pengakswsan penyimpanan sekunder 
    yang   disediakan sistem operasi
 
 
Faktor utama yang menentukan kepuasan dan ketidakpuasan pemakai sistem
basisdata adalah fungsionalitas dan kinerja DBMS

Salah satu kriteria kinerja DBMS adalah waktu tanggap (response time). Jika  
waktu tanggap DBMS terlalu lama berarti nilai kinerja sistem buruk
 
Sasaran komputasi adalah menyediakan informasi di mana keputusan dapat
dibuat dan tindakan-tindakan dapat dilakukan
 
Data di simpan dalam DBMS , di mana DBMS menyimpannya dalam file file
rekord-rekord dan hubungan antar tecord dalam file file
Terdapat beberapa operasi mendasar terhadap record dalam file :
Insert record
Modify record
Search a record
Read the entire file
Reorganize the file
 
 
 

Tidak ada komentar:

Posting Komentar